mirror of
https://github.com/radzenhq/radzen-blazor.git
synced 2026-02-04 05:35:44 +00:00
demo updated
This commit is contained in:
@@ -1,4 +1,4 @@
|
||||
@using Radzen
|
||||
@using Radzen
|
||||
@using RadzenBlazorDemos.Data
|
||||
@using RadzenBlazorDemos.Models.Northwind
|
||||
@using Microsoft.EntityFrameworkCore
|
||||
@@ -13,7 +13,7 @@
|
||||
|
||||
<RadzenButton Click="@(args => Settings = null)" Text="Clear saved settings" Style="margin-bottom: 16px" />
|
||||
<RadzenButton Click="@(args => NavigationManager.NavigateTo("/datagrid-save-settings-loaddata", true))" Text="Reload" Style="margin-bottom: 16px" />
|
||||
<RadzenDataGrid @ref=grid @bind-Settings="@Settings" LoadSettings="@LoadSettings" AllowFiltering="true" AllowColumnPicking="true" AllowGrouping="true" AllowPaging="true"
|
||||
<RadzenDataGrid @ref=grid @bind-Settings="@Settings" LoadSettings="@LoadSettings" TItem="Employee" PickedColumnsChanged="@OnPickedColumnsChanged" AllowFiltering="true" AllowColumnPicking="true" AllowGrouping="true" AllowPaging="true"
|
||||
AllowSorting="true" AllowMultiColumnSorting="true" ShowMultiColumnSortingIndex="true"
|
||||
AllowColumnResize="true" AllowColumnReorder="true" ColumnWidth="200px"
|
||||
FilterPopupRenderMode="PopupRenderMode.OnDemand" FilterCaseSensitivity="FilterCaseSensitivity.CaseInsensitive"
|
||||
@@ -140,4 +140,9 @@
|
||||
args.Settings = Settings;
|
||||
}
|
||||
}
|
||||
|
||||
async Task OnPickedColumnsChanged(DataGridPickedColumnsChangedEventArgs<Employee> args)
|
||||
{
|
||||
await SaveStateAsync();
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user